The click MAG
Have you heard the click?
The one that keeps you in groups?
The one that makes it so you're only friends with certain people who can be in a loop?
Psh click clack patty whack give a dog a bone.
Makes me sick seeing people act like they're on a throne.
Have you heard the click?
The one that can put anything online for anyone to see?
Even if it's only briefly
Seems to me to be a little creepy.
Have you heard the click?
It's the sound of a brick.
It's quite basic.
Yet the click hurts people it's like a cut down, face in the ground and when it goes
on it's like a countdown, like sundown leaves you with a frown, and ready for a meltdown.
Have you heard the click?
It's the one that leaves you lovesick, feeling like you need a medic.
It makes you feel like life is a comic and nearly cultic like the latest flick ready to rip like fabric.
The click is manmade like plastic, it's not natural it's toxic.
But maybe just maybe if we learn to sit back and not pay attention to the traffic then I think we have a chance.
To break the click and go with a little bit of logic.
